Materials Matter: What Your Eraser is Made Of

The material of an eraser greatly affects how well it works with colored pencils.

Vinyl or Plastic Erasers

These are often the top choice for colored pencils. They are synthetic and can be formulated to be very soft. This softness allows them to lift pigment gently. They also tend to create less dust than other types.

Rubber Erasers

Traditional rubber erasers can be effective, but some can be too abrasive for colored pencils. Softer rubber erasers are better. They can sometimes leave behind more residue.

Kneaded Erasers

These are moldable erasers, like putty. They work by lifting pigment rather than rubbing it away. Kneaded erasers are excellent for subtly lightening areas or creating soft highlights. They don’t leave behind shavings, but they can pick up dirt from your paper, so you need to keep them clean.

User Experience and Use Cases: How to Use Your Eraser

How you use an eraser depends on what you want to achieve.

Correcting Mistakes

For accidental marks or lines, a vinyl eraser is usually your best bet. Gently rub the eraser over the mistake until the color lifts. You might need to use a light touch to avoid damaging the paper.

Lightening Areas

If you want to make a colored area lighter, a kneaded eraser is perfect. Press the kneaded eraser onto the colored area. It will lift some of the pigment, creating a softer tone. You can also gently “dab” or “roll” the kneaded eraser to lift color.

Creating Highlights

Artists use erasers to create bright spots or highlights in their colored pencil drawings. A sharp edge of a vinyl eraser or a pointed kneaded eraser can carefully remove color to show the white of the paper or a lighter layer underneath.

Blending and Softening

A clean kneaded eraser can also be used to gently blend or soften colored pencil strokes. It helps create a smoother transition between colors.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) About Colored Pencil Erasers

Q: Can I use a regular pink eraser for colored pencils?

A: Regular pink erasers can sometimes smudge colored pencils or damage the paper. It’s usually better to use erasers specifically designed for art, like vinyl or kneaded erasers.

Q: What is the best type of eraser for colored pencils?

A: Vinyl or plastic erasers are often recommended because they are gentle and erase cleanly. Kneaded erasers are also excellent for lightening and special effects.

Q: How do I prevent smudging when erasing colored pencils?

A: Use a light touch and a good quality eraser. Avoid rubbing too hard. Also, try to erase only when necessary.

Q: Can erasers remove all colored pencil marks?

A: Most erasers can lighten colored pencil marks significantly. However, very dark or heavily applied colors might leave a faint shadow behind.

Q: How do I clean a kneaded eraser?

A: You can clean a kneaded eraser by repeatedly folding and stretching it. This pushes the absorbed pigment to the inside. Eventually, it will become too dark to use effectively and needs to be replaced.

Q: Can I use an electric eraser with colored pencils?

A: Electric erasers can be very effective but can also be powerful. Use them with extreme caution on colored pencils, as they can easily damage the paper or remove too much color.

Q: Are art gum erasers good for colored pencils?

A: Art gum erasers are softer than some rubber erasers. They can work for light erasing, but they tend to crumble a lot and might not be as effective as vinyl or kneaded erasers for colored pencils.

Q: What is the difference between a vinyl eraser and a plastic eraser?

A: The terms are often used interchangeably. Both are synthetic and designed for clean, gentle erasing.

Q: Can I use an eraser to blend colors?

A: Yes, a clean kneaded eraser can be used to gently blend or soften colored pencil areas.

Q: How do I choose an eraser for detailed work?

A: Look for erasers with fine tips or smaller sizes. Some brands offer precision erasers that are perfect for detailed corrections and highlights.
